The Role of Cognitive Biases in Gambling
Cognitive biases significantly impact decision-making in gambling scenarios. For instance, the illusion of control leads many gamblers to believe they can influence outcomes, especially in games like slots or roulette. This overestimation of one’s ability often results in players making riskier bets, ignoring the inherent randomness of these games. Another notable bias is the gambler’s fallacy, where individuals think that past outcomes affect future results. For example, if a roulette wheel has landed on red several times in a row, a player might feel that black is “due” to come up next. These biases create a distorted understanding of probability, affecting how players place their bets.
The Impact of Emotions on Betting Behavior
Emotions play a crucial role in gambling choices. When players experience excitement or adrenaline, they may make impulsive decisions without fully considering the risks involved. This emotional arousal can lead to increased betting amounts, as the thrill of the moment can overshadow rational thinking. On the flip side, negative emotions, such as frustration or disappointment, can also influence betting behavior, leading to reckless financial decisions.
A player who has suffered losses might chase those losses by increasing their bets, hoping to regain their previous stakes. This cycle can lead to poor financial decisions and potentially problematic gambling behavior.
The Social Environment and Gambling Decisions
The social context in which gambling occurs can shape one’s betting behavior. For instance, peer pressure may encourage individuals to place larger or riskier bets, especially in social settings where gambling is viewed as a shared experience. The desire to fit in or impress others can lead to decisions that might not align with an individual’s typical betting strategy.
Additionally, the presence of others can enhance the excitement of gambling, creating an atmosphere that encourages further betting. This social influence may result in players taking risks they wouldn’t normally consider if gambling alone, ultimately affecting their overall strategy and outcomes.
The Legal Landscape of Gambling and Its Influence
The legal framework surrounding gambling also plays a significant role in shaping betting behaviors. In regions where gambling is heavily regulated, players may feel more secure and inclined to participate, believing that legal oversight guarantees fairness. This perception can lead to increased betting activity, as players feel reassured about the legitimacy of their games.
On the other hand, in areas with less regulation, there may be a greater emphasis on online and underground gambling options. This can lead to riskier betting practices, as individuals may encounter unregulated games where odds are not transparent. Understanding the legal landscape is essential for players to make informed decisions about their gambling habits.
